Thousands of people are still without water since yesterday as the Water Authority of Fiji continue repair works on a burst main along Queens Road.
People living in Tacirua, Lami and parts of Tamavua are facing water disruptions.
The Water Authority has confirmed that services will be gradually restored later today.
The Authority has also confirmed that water carting trucks are on standby and will service the routes if and when the need arises.
